Spring stocktake

There are gaps in the housing dataset. Some data is not collected, other data is exposed to privacy and cyber vulnerabilities. One data set that would help inform policy-makers is the level of unmet demand for adequate housing. From thermal comfort to climate-adaptation, homelessness to structural defects, overcrowding to accessibility, we're going to design a mission to source the data, the data access principles and the things we can do to fill the gaps while we do it.

The Global Urban Monitoring Framework

UN Habitat

A set of metrics to help cities and urban areas evaluate their progress on sustainable urban development goals. It includes Voluntary Local Reviews in its reporting.
